Forem

Daniel Azevedo  profile picture

Daniel Azevedo

C# developer passionate about clean code and design patterns. Sharing insights on software architecture, coding best practices, and tech tips. Join me on this journey to better code!

Location Portugal Joined Joined on 
AG-2 in Practice #8 – Deploying AG-2 Agents in Real-World Applications
Cover image for AG-2 in Practice #8 – Deploying AG-2 Agents in Real-World Applications

AG-2 in Practice #8 – Deploying AG-2 Agents in Real-World Applications

4
Comments 1
2 min read

Want to connect with Daniel Azevedo ?

Create an account to connect with Daniel Azevedo . You can also sign in below to proceed if you already have an account.

Already have an account? Sign in
AG-2 in Practice #7 – Getting Started with AG2 Studio (No-Code Agent Workflows)
Cover image for AG-2 in Practice #7 – Getting Started with AG2 Studio (No-Code Agent Workflows)

AG-2 in Practice #7 – Getting Started with AG2 Studio (No-Code Agent Workflows)

Comments
2 min read
AG-2 in Practice #6 – Human-in-the-Loop (HITL) Workflows
Cover image for AG-2 in Practice #6 – Human-in-the-Loop (HITL) Workflows

AG-2 in Practice #6 – Human-in-the-Loop (HITL) Workflows

Comments
2 min read
AG-2 in Practice #5 – Building Custom Patterns and Integrating Tools
Cover image for AG-2 in Practice #5 – Building Custom Patterns and Integrating Tools

AG-2 in Practice #5 – Building Custom Patterns and Integrating Tools

2
Comments
2 min read
AG-2 in Practice #4 – Using Patterns to Structure Multi-Agent Workflows
Cover image for AG-2 in Practice #4 – Using Patterns to Structure Multi-Agent Workflows

AG-2 in Practice #4 – Using Patterns to Structure Multi-Agent Workflows

Comments
2 min read
AG-2 in Practice #3 – Creating a Multi-Agent Workflow (Researcher + Writer)
Cover image for AG-2 in Practice #3 – Creating a Multi-Agent Workflow (Researcher + Writer)

AG-2 in Practice #3 – Creating a Multi-Agent Workflow (Researcher + Writer)

Comments
2 min read
AG-2 in Practice #2 – Setting Up AG-2 and Creating Your First Agent
Cover image for AG-2 in Practice #2 – Setting Up AG-2 and Creating Your First Agent

AG-2 in Practice #2 – Setting Up AG-2 and Creating Your First Agent

Comments
2 min read
AG-2 in Practice #1 – What is AG-2 and How Does It Work?
Cover image for AG-2 in Practice #1 – What is AG-2 and How Does It Work?

AG-2 in Practice #1 – What is AG-2 and How Does It Work?

Comments 1
3 min read
The Mediator Pattern: Simplifying Communication in Complex Systems
Cover image for The Mediator Pattern: Simplifying Communication in Complex Systems

The Mediator Pattern: Simplifying Communication in Complex Systems

1
Comments
3 min read
Azure Event Grid: Simplifying Event-Driven Architectures
Cover image for Azure Event Grid: Simplifying Event-Driven Architectures

Azure Event Grid: Simplifying Event-Driven Architectures

Comments
3 min read
Understanding WebSockets: Real-Time Communication Made Simple
Cover image for Understanding WebSockets: Real-Time Communication Made Simple

Understanding WebSockets: Real-Time Communication Made Simple

Comments
3 min read
What is SignalR? A Real-Time Communication Framework for .NET
Cover image for What is SignalR? A Real-Time Communication Framework for .NET

What is SignalR? A Real-Time Communication Framework for .NET

2
Comments
3 min read
Blazor and Single-Page Applications (SPA)
Cover image for Blazor and Single-Page Applications (SPA)

Blazor and Single-Page Applications (SPA)

7
Comments
3 min read
Logging with Serilog, Elastic Stack, and Kibana
Cover image for Logging with Serilog, Elastic Stack, and Kibana

Logging with Serilog, Elastic Stack, and Kibana

8
Comments
3 min read
JWT in Microservices
Cover image for JWT in Microservices

JWT in Microservices

2
Comments
3 min read
OAuth2 in Microservices
Cover image for OAuth2 in Microservices

OAuth2 in Microservices

1
Comments
3 min read
RabbitMQ: Fanout Exchange Pattern.
Cover image for RabbitMQ: Fanout Exchange Pattern.

RabbitMQ: Fanout Exchange Pattern.

Comments
3 min read
RabbitMQ: Using It with Microservices
Cover image for RabbitMQ: Using It with Microservices

RabbitMQ: Using It with Microservices

1
Comments
3 min read
Event Broker Implementation in C# Using Azure Service Bus
Cover image for Event Broker Implementation in C# Using Azure Service Bus

Event Broker Implementation in C# Using Azure Service Bus

2
Comments
3 min read
Choreography vs. Orchestration in Microservices: What’s the Right Choice?
Cover image for Choreography vs. Orchestration in Microservices: What’s the Right Choice?

Choreography vs. Orchestration in Microservices: What’s the Right Choice?

Comments
3 min read
The Saga Pattern in Microservices
Cover image for The Saga Pattern in Microservices

The Saga Pattern in Microservices

1
Comments 1
3 min read
Circuit Breaker Pattern -Building Resilience
Cover image for Circuit Breaker Pattern -Building Resilience

Circuit Breaker Pattern -Building Resilience

2
Comments
4 min read
Understanding RPC in Microservices
Cover image for Understanding RPC in Microservices

Understanding RPC in Microservices

1
Comments 1
4 min read
Understanding Server-Side Composition and Client-Side Composition in Microservices
Cover image for Understanding Server-Side Composition and Client-Side Composition in Microservices

Understanding Server-Side Composition and Client-Side Composition in Microservices

3
Comments
4 min read
Akka, RabbitMQ, Kafka, and Azure Service Bus in Microservices Architecture
Cover image for Akka, RabbitMQ, Kafka, and Azure Service Bus in Microservices Architecture

Akka, RabbitMQ, Kafka, and Azure Service Bus in Microservices Architecture

5
Comments
4 min read
Bounded Contexts with Azure Service Bus: Scaling Domain-Driven Design
Cover image for Bounded Contexts with Azure Service Bus: Scaling Domain-Driven Design

Bounded Contexts with Azure Service Bus: Scaling Domain-Driven Design

1
Comments
4 min read
SOA vs. Microservices: Key Differences and When to Use Each
Cover image for SOA vs. Microservices: Key Differences and When to Use Each

SOA vs. Microservices: Key Differences and When to Use Each

Comments
3 min read
Domain-Centric Architecture: Building Software That Aligns With Business Needs
Cover image for Domain-Centric Architecture: Building Software That Aligns With Business Needs

Domain-Centric Architecture: Building Software That Aligns With Business Needs

6
Comments
4 min read
What is Clean Code?
Cover image for What is Clean Code?

What is Clean Code?

23
Comments 10
3 min read
Understanding the Visitor Pattern in C#
Cover image for Understanding the Visitor Pattern in C#

Understanding the Visitor Pattern in C#

3
Comments
4 min read
GitHub Spark: Create Apps with Ease and No Code
Cover image for GitHub Spark: Create Apps with Ease and No Code

GitHub Spark: Create Apps with Ease and No Code

9
Comments
2 min read
Top 6 Design Patterns
Cover image for Top 6 Design Patterns

Top 6 Design Patterns

1
Comments
3 min read
AI Feedback Analysis with the Facade Pattern
Cover image for AI Feedback Analysis with the Facade Pattern

AI Feedback Analysis with the Facade Pattern

1
Comments
3 min read
Implementing a Perceptron from Scratch in Python
Cover image for Implementing a Perceptron from Scratch in Python

Implementing a Perceptron from Scratch in Python

7
Comments
3 min read
Flyweight Pattern in C# – Optimize Your Memory Usage!
Cover image for Flyweight Pattern in C# – Optimize Your Memory Usage!

Flyweight Pattern in C# – Optimize Your Memory Usage!

2
Comments
4 min read
Keras: Understanding the Basics with a Detailed Example
Cover image for Keras: Understanding the Basics with a Detailed Example

Keras: Understanding the Basics with a Detailed Example

Comments
4 min read
TensorFlow vs. PyTorch: Which Deep Learning Framework is Right for You?
Cover image for TensorFlow vs. PyTorch: Which Deep Learning Framework is Right for You?

TensorFlow vs. PyTorch: Which Deep Learning Framework is Right for You?

2
Comments
2 min read
Understanding the Proxy Pattern with a Payroll System Example
Cover image for Understanding the Proxy Pattern with a Payroll System Example

Understanding the Proxy Pattern with a Payroll System Example

4
Comments 1
4 min read
Understanding the Open/Closed Principle (OCP) from SOLID: Keep Code Flexible Yet Stable
Cover image for Understanding the Open/Closed Principle (OCP) from SOLID: Keep Code Flexible Yet Stable

Understanding the Open/Closed Principle (OCP) from SOLID: Keep Code Flexible Yet Stable

Comments 1
2 min read
Why Apache Kafka, Docker, and C#?
Cover image for Why Apache Kafka, Docker, and C#?

Why Apache Kafka, Docker, and C#?

1
Comments
3 min read
Orchestration vs. Choreography: Understanding Two Approaches in System Integration
Cover image for Orchestration vs. Choreography: Understanding Two Approaches in System Integration

Orchestration vs. Choreography: Understanding Two Approaches in System Integration

Comments
2 min read
Exploring Apache Kafka: A Beginner's Guide to Stream Processing
Cover image for Exploring Apache Kafka: A Beginner's Guide to Stream Processing

Exploring Apache Kafka: A Beginner's Guide to Stream Processing

6
Comments 1
2 min read
Streamlining DevOps with AZD CLI: A Deep Dive into CI/CD
Cover image for Streamlining DevOps with AZD CLI: A Deep Dive into CI/CD

Streamlining DevOps with AZD CLI: A Deep Dive into CI/CD

3
Comments
2 min read
The End of Microservices? Time to Rethink Software Architecture?
Cover image for The End of Microservices? Time to Rethink Software Architecture?

The End of Microservices? Time to Rethink Software Architecture?

1
Comments
3 min read
Lesson 12 - What is TensorFlow?
Cover image for Lesson 12 - What is TensorFlow?

Lesson 12 - What is TensorFlow?

1
Comments
4 min read
Lesson 11 – Getting Started with TensorFlow, Docker, and Kubernetes
Cover image for Lesson 11 – Getting Started with TensorFlow, Docker, and Kubernetes

Lesson 11 – Getting Started with TensorFlow, Docker, and Kubernetes

4
Comments 1
3 min read
What Every Developer Should Know About Cybersecurity (Especially in the AI Era)
Cover image for What Every Developer Should Know About Cybersecurity (Especially in the AI Era)

What Every Developer Should Know About Cybersecurity (Especially in the AI Era)

1
Comments 1
3 min read
Facade Pattern: Simplifying Complex Systems
Cover image for Facade Pattern: Simplifying Complex Systems

Facade Pattern: Simplifying Complex Systems

Comments
3 min read
The Bridge Pattern: Simplifying Code Structure with Flexibility
Cover image for The Bridge Pattern: Simplifying Code Structure with Flexibility

The Bridge Pattern: Simplifying Code Structure with Flexibility

Comments
3 min read
AI-900 Series: Exploring Features of Generative AI Workloads on Azure
Cover image for AI-900 Series: Exploring Features of Generative AI Workloads on Azure

AI-900 Series: Exploring Features of Generative AI Workloads on Azure

1
Comments 1
4 min read
AI-900 Series: Exploring Features of Natural Language Processing (NLP) Workloads on Azure
Cover image for AI-900 Series: Exploring Features of Natural Language Processing (NLP) Workloads on Azure

AI-900 Series: Exploring Features of Natural Language Processing (NLP) Workloads on Azure

Comments 1
4 min read
AI-900 Series: Exploring Features of Computer Vision Workloads on Azure
Cover image for AI-900 Series: Exploring Features of Computer Vision Workloads on Azure

AI-900 Series: Exploring Features of Computer Vision Workloads on Azure

1
Comments 1
3 min read
AI-900 Series: Fundamental Principles of Machine Learning on Azure
Cover image for AI-900 Series: Fundamental Principles of Machine Learning on Azure

AI-900 Series: Fundamental Principles of Machine Learning on Azure

1
Comments 1
4 min read
AI-900 Series: Understanding AI Workloads and Considerations
Cover image for AI-900 Series: Understanding AI Workloads and Considerations

AI-900 Series: Understanding AI Workloads and Considerations

7
Comments 1
3 min read
The End of the Software Developer Era?
Cover image for The End of the Software Developer Era?

The End of the Software Developer Era?

1
Comments
3 min read
4 - Clean Architecture: Interface Adapters
Cover image for 4 - Clean Architecture: Interface Adapters

4 - Clean Architecture: Interface Adapters

5
Comments
3 min read
3 - Clean Architecture: Understanding Use Cases
Cover image for 3 - Clean Architecture: Understanding Use Cases

3 - Clean Architecture: Understanding Use Cases

18
Comments
3 min read
2 - Clean Architecture: Entities and Business Logic
Cover image for 2 - Clean Architecture: Entities and Business Logic

2 - Clean Architecture: Entities and Business Logic

9
Comments 1
4 min read
1 - Clean Architecture: A Simpler Approach to Software Design
Cover image for 1 - Clean Architecture: A Simpler Approach to Software Design

1 - Clean Architecture: A Simpler Approach to Software Design

2
Comments 1
4 min read
Law of Demeter (Principle of Least Knowledge)
Cover image for Law of Demeter (Principle of Least Knowledge)

Law of Demeter (Principle of Least Knowledge)

1
Comments 7
3 min read
loading...